WebAn iPhone takes around 5 minutes (depending on the phone) before it can turn on again, while an Android phone takes around 20 seconds before you can turn it on after plugging in the charger. EDIT: One thing to note is that this is not the case for Apple's laptops, those turn on immediately. This thread is archived
WebOne time it took 30 minutes to turn back on. The phone has to charge the battery sufficiently to survive being pulled off AC before it’ll let you use it again. Given the smaller mini battery, it might take a little longer for it to reach a charge that it deems sufficient. Moral of the story: stop draining your phone battery completely, it is ...
